Six tips to save at DFDS

1. Know when to book and be flexible

Timing is everything when it comes to saving money on travel. Choosing off-peak times, such as midweek or on overnight sailings, is significantly cheaper, sometimes saving you up to 50 per cent. For instance, afternoon departures from Dover are often cheaper and night ferries between midnight and 6am tend to have more affordable spaces available.

Planning ahead also pays off (literally). As with most travel providers, DFDS typically offers lower fares to those who book in advance. So, if you know your travel dates, securing your tickets in advance can help you lock in the best prices.

3. Student, young people and senior discounts

DFDS offers a 20 per cent discount on selected routes for students aged 18 to 27, young people aged 18 to 25 and seniors over 60. For example, right now there is 20 per cent off sailings from Newhaven to Dieppe. To take advantage of these savings, simply verify your eligibility and present a valid ID at the port.

6. Duty-free shopping

Bonus tip: don't forget to browse DFDS's duty-free shops onboard and at ports including Calais and Dunkerque. You can save up to 50 per cent compared to UK high street prices on items such as spirits, perfumes, Lego and confectionery. For added convenience, use the reserve and collect service to shop online before your trip and pick up your purchases before you sail.

Helpful booking information

Best Price Guarantee

The DFDS best price guarantee means you can book with peace of mind that if you find a cheaper fare for the same crossing elsewhere within 24 hours, you’ll be refunded an extra 10 per cent of the difference. Just be sure to provide evidence, such as a screenshot with all the details, as soon as possible after booking.

Cancellation Policy

DFDS cancellation policies vary depending on your ticket type and route, so we highly recommend double-checking before you book. For example, for Dover to Calais/Dunkirk routes, economy tickets are non-refundable whereas premium tickets can be cancelled up to 48 hours before departure.

All refund requests must be made in writing within three months of the cancellation date.

Families

If you’re travelling with children, you’re in luck. Most DFDS routes offer child-friendly entertainment, such as treasure hunts, face-painting and play areas with mascots like Jack the pirate . Plus, children under three travel and dine free of charge, without needing their own seat or bed. Don’t forget to check out the DFDS offers page for regular family-specific discounts.

Pet owners

Your furry friends are also welcome on board DFDS crossings. As a part of the DEFRA Pet Travel Scheme (PETS), travelling abroad with dogs and other pets is made straightforward and stress free.

Groups

Large groups can save with DFDS’s group vehicle saver offer and get 10 per cent off when booking 10 or more cars or bikes on routes such as Newcastle to Amsterdam and Dover to France. Extra benefits include paying a 25 per cent deposit upon booking, with the remaining balance due eight weeks before departure.
